Patents Examined by Hassan Khan
-
Patent number: 11470028Abstract: A system for interactive e-commerce using email, includes a server running an e-commerce website and a supporting database; the server sending an order confirmation email to a user in response to a user purchase; the email containing an interactivity script and an update script; wherein, upon the user using an email client to render the email, the interactivity script connects to the server and provides the user with an interface for feedback to the e-commerce website regarding the user purchase; and wherein, upon the user using the email client to render the email, the update script connects to the server and provides the user with an updated status of the purchase based on data in the supporting database.Type: GrantFiled: December 11, 2020Date of Patent: October 11, 2022Assignee: Ecwid, Inc.Inventors: Ruslan Fazlyev, Erik Suhonen, Den Nikiforov, Alexander Dryantsov, Alexey Radionov
-
Patent number: 11463321Abstract: A method and apparatus for creating a custom service in a communication network are disclosed. For example, the method implemented via a processor determines that the custom service does not exist, receives one or more desired functions for the custom service, creates the custom service having the one or more desired functions and modifies one or more network elements within the communication network to perform the one or more desired functions to deploy the custom service.Type: GrantFiled: March 1, 2021Date of Patent: October 4, 2022Assignee: AT&T Intellectual Property I, L.P.Inventors: Walter Cooper Chastain, Reuben Klein
-
Patent number: 11449909Abstract: Described herein are systems, apparatus, methods and computer program products for implementing dynamic API cost models. The dynamic API cost models may determine the cost of usage of a specific API based on a plurality of factors, such as the value of the API to the client as well as the usage of computational resources and other factors.Type: GrantFiled: January 24, 2020Date of Patent: September 20, 2022Assignee: salesforce.com, inc.Inventors: Dinesh Weerapurage, Lahiru Pileththuwasan Gallege, Kenneth Cavagnolo, Chris Groer, Abraham Reyes
-
Patent number: 11409550Abstract: A computing system providing virtual computing services may generate and manage remote computing sessions between client devices and virtual desktop instances (workspaces) hosted on the service provider's network. The system may implement a virtual private cloud for a workspaces service that extends out to gateway components in multiple, geographically distributed point of presence (POP) locations. In response to a client request for a virtual desktop session, the service may configure a virtual computing resource instance for the session and establish a secure, reliable, low latency communication channel (over a virtual private network) between the resource instance and a gateway component at a POP location near the client for communication of a two-way interactive video stream for the session. The availability zone containing the POP location may be different than one hosting the resource instance for the session. Client devices may connect to the gateway component over a public network.Type: GrantFiled: April 19, 2019Date of Patent: August 9, 2022Assignee: Amazon Technologies, Inc.Inventors: Deepak Suryanarayanan, Sheshadri Supreeth Koushik, Nicholas Patrick Wilt, Kalyanaraman Prasad
-
Patent number: 11411846Abstract: A method and a device for hotspot leasing are provided. The method comprises: acquiring a data request packet transmitted by a requesting user (S11); based on a target data request packet acquired by a supplying user from the data request packet, transmitting hotspot information provided by the supplying user to the requesting user corresponding to the target data request packet, and establishing a hotspot leasing contract between the requesting user and the supplying user (S12). Therefore, demand docking is provided for both parties of leasing and selling by means of the data request packet, so that users with excess data provide data to users with data gaps. Urgent needs of one or more surrounding users are solved, near-field social contact for mutual assistance is established, and data utilization is improved.Type: GrantFiled: February 28, 2020Date of Patent: August 9, 2022Assignee: SHANGHAI SHANGWANG NETWORK TECHNOLOGY CO., LTD.Inventor: Tingting Yu
-
Patent number: 11403151Abstract: An autoscale-type performance assurance system performs autoscaling to increase or reduce the number of VMs/containers V1 to V4 generated in a server and resources of V1 to V4. A compute includes a plurality of types of V1 to V4, a data collection unit that collects a resource allocation amount of V1 to V4, and a resource control unit that performs autoscaling to increase or reduce the amount of resources of V1 to V4 according to a resource control amount. A controller includes a dependency calculation unit that calculates, based on the collected resource allocation amount, a degree of dependency indicating whether the resource allocation amount is dependent on a performance related to V1 to V4 for providing a communication service quality, and an autoscaling determination unit that obtains a resource control amount for increasing or reducing only resources related to the calculated degree of dependency indicating being dependent.Type: GrantFiled: January 17, 2020Date of Patent: August 2, 2022Assignee: Nippon Telegraph and Telephone CorporationInventor: Yoshito Ito
-
Patent number: 11388224Abstract: Example methods and apparatus for managing user information of an application are described. One example method is applied to a user management device of a cloud platform, where the cloud platform is configured to bear an application registered by a user with the cloud platform. The method includes receiving a user management registration request of a first application, where the first application is one of applications registered with the cloud platform, and the user management registration request of the first application carries an identifier of the first application. A user management instance is created for the first application according to the user management registration request and the identifier of the first application, where the user management instance is used to manage user information of the first application. The user management instance is invoked to process a service that is in the first application and related to the user information.Type: GrantFiled: March 23, 2021Date of Patent: July 12, 2022Assignee: Huawei Technologies Co., Ltd.Inventor: Ming Liang
-
Patent number: 11381467Abstract: Disclosed is a method for generating synthetic data from an aggregate dataset related to a plurality of entities. The method comprises defining a set of personas, selecting a network generation model, defining a network topology and generating the synthetic data. The set of personas is defined based on a number of the plurality of entities and/or a type of at least one of the plurality of entities. The network generation model is selected based on the defined set of personas and the aggregate dataset related thereto. The generated network topology comprises nodes and links between nodes using the selected network generation model. The node represents one of the personas in the set of personas. The link between two nodes represent one or more transactions between the personas represented by the two nodes. The generated synthetic data is based on information about distribution of the one or more transactions.Type: GrantFiled: September 16, 2020Date of Patent: July 5, 2022Inventors: Kimmo Soramäki, Samantha Cook, Lubos Pernis
-
Patent number: 11349785Abstract: Disclosed are systems and methods for conducting an open conversation user interface and more particularly, to a channel-agnostic user interface experience which can utilize automated background intelligence to simplify the exchange between a software system or member service representative (MSR) and a member, and avoids the need for web-based free form inputs.Type: GrantFiled: January 25, 2021Date of Patent: May 31, 2022Assignee: UIPCO, LLCInventors: Ian Smith, Jeremy Mark Fisher, Heather Hernandez
-
Patent number: 11349925Abstract: A system and method in a building or vehicle for an actuator operation in response to a sensor according to a control logic, the system comprising a router or a gateway communicating with a device associated with the sensor and a device associated with the actuator over in-building or in-vehicle networks, and an external Internet-connected control server associated with the control logic implementing a PID closed linear control loop and communicating with the router over external network for controlling the in-building or in-vehicle phenomenon. The sensor may be a microphone or a camera, and the system may include voice or image processing as part of the control logic. A redundancy is used by using multiple sensors or actuators, or by using multiple data paths over the building or vehicle internal or external communication. The networks may be wired or wireless, and may be BAN, PAN, LAN, WAN, or home networks.Type: GrantFiled: May 30, 2018Date of Patent: May 31, 2022Assignee: May Patents Ltd.Inventors: Yehuda Binder, Benjamin Maytal
-
Patent number: 11348147Abstract: This disclosure comprises a solution that can sort objects based on values under various circumstances for the purpose of grouping objects and determining recommended placement or disposition of the objects. An object can be assigned a monetary value, a sentimental value, and a practical value. The practical value can be entered individually for the object via the web or virtual assistant access to the object inventory. The practical value can also be estimated via sensors on or proximate to the object that can sense activity related to the object.Type: GrantFiled: April 17, 2020Date of Patent: May 31, 2022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.Inventors: Brittaney Zellner, Sameena Khan, Ryan Schaub, Barrett Kreiner, Ari Craine, Robert Koch
-
Patent number: 11336726Abstract: A system and method in a building or vehicle for an actuator operation in response to a sensor according to a control logic, the system comprising a router or a gateway communicating with a device associated with the sensor and a device associated with the actuator over in-building or in-vehicle networks, and an external Internet-connected control server associated with the control logic implementing a PID closed linear control loop and communicating with the router over external network for controlling the in-building or in-vehicle phenomenon. The sensor may be a microphone or a camera, and the system may include voice or image processing as part of the control logic. A redundancy is used by using multiple sensors or actuators, or by using multiple data paths over the building or vehicle internal or external communication. The networks may be wired or wireless, and may be BAN, PAN, LAN, WAN, or home networks.Type: GrantFiled: May 15, 2020Date of Patent: May 17, 2022Assignee: May Patents Ltd.Inventors: Yehuda Binder, Benjamin Maytal
-
Patent number: 11336727Abstract: Systems, devices, and methods for asset tracking through specialized connectors and specialized casing units are provided. An example system includes an asset tracking device and a specialized casing unit to house the asset tracking device and to connect the asset tracking device to a communication port of an asset. The asset tracking device includes a communication port interface to interface with the communication port of the asset directly, and to interface with the communication port of the asset through the specialized casing unit. The asset tracking device further includes a controller to determine whether the asset tracking device is interfaced with the communication port of the asset directly or through the specialized casing unit, and when it is determined that the asset tracking device is interfaced with the communication port of the asset through the specialized casing unit, configure the asset tracking device to operate in a specialized operating mode.Type: GrantFiled: September 1, 2020Date of Patent: May 17, 2022Assignee: Geotab Inc.Inventors: Thomas Arthur Walli, Michael Pirruccio, Paul Philip Ciolek
-
Patent number: 11334838Abstract: Disclosed is a business model generation support method for proposing a new business model. A computer receives a first business model and a second business model, and adds, for the plurality of business models, a first activity and a second activity which are respectively performed by the first and second business models to first information that predefines jobs performed by the business models as activities. Next, the computer adds the relation between a first data item and the first activity and the relation between a second data item and the second activity to second information that predefines the relation between the activities and the data items used for performing the activities. The first and second data items are used for performing the first and second activities, respectively. Then, the computer searches the second information to obtain a third activity including both the first data item and the second data item.Type: GrantFiled: April 25, 2019Date of Patent: May 17, 2022Assignee: HITACHI, LTD.Inventors: Yuri Okada, Yusuke Jin, Nishio Yamada
-
Patent number: 11329934Abstract: An information management apparatus starts a conversation with a chatbot on an information processing terminal in response to a received chat start instruction, and based on the content of the conversation, sends recommend information related to a service to the information processing terminal. The information management apparatus sends pass information that enables access to user information received from the information processing terminal, the pass information being sent to an information processing device that corresponds to a provider of the service, when information indicating a desire to use the service is received from the information processing terminal in response to the recommend information. The information management apparatus deletes the user information when receiving from the information processing device, acknowledgment indicating that the service can be provided to the user that corresponds to the user information accessed using the pass information.Type: GrantFiled: January 27, 2021Date of Patent: May 10, 2022Assignee: FUJITSU LIMITEDInventors: Hiroshi Matsuyama, Shinji Narukawa
-
Patent number: 11316918Abstract: A mission-specific computer peripheral provides a portable linkable work platform, useful for establishing a collaborative electronic work group quickly, at low cost, and without professional computing expertise. The office infrastructure device (“OID”) includes data storage (for storage of system and user data files), a unique device identification code (for identification when the device is plugged into a host personal computer), and an index (for registering user data files available within the work group). When connected, user executable code within the device is accessed through the host personal computer to launch thereon a user-definable work space. The work space provides, among other office infrastructure functions, access to programming that enables sharing of personal user work and data files among the authorized member nodes of the work group. The sharing is facilitated by the index, preferably in combination with a complementary work group server integrated within the underlying OID network.Type: GrantFiled: November 24, 2017Date of Patent: April 26, 2022Inventor: Renato M. de Luna
-
Patent number: 11301916Abstract: A promotion processing system may include a remote device and a promotion server. The promotion server may be configured to generate a promotion within a social media feed. The promotion may be associated with a given product brand. The promotion server may be configured to operate a chatbot conversation on the remote device corresponding to the promotion. The chatbot may be operated to determine a recommended product within the given product brand, validate a purchase of the recommended product, and permit redemption of the promotion based upon validation of the purchase.Type: GrantFiled: October 16, 2019Date of Patent: April 12, 2022Assignee: INMAR CLEARING, INC.Inventors: Jeffery Hayes, Gregory Clem, Nathanael Georgeson, Tyler Lenderman, Lee Lovett, Samuel May, O'Ryan McEntire, Zackary Wolfe
-
Patent number: 11296947Abstract: The present invention relates to a software defined networking in a wide area network (SD-WAN) device, comprising a network monitor which observes and gathers network parameters reflecting network conditions and stores them to a database; a metrics collector which receives and gathers node parameters reflecting node status stores them to the database, a traffic manager which performs a traffic evaluation on the network parameters or node parameters to identify if a network traffic level is within a performance range, and a policy engine which performs a mitigation evaluation on the analysis done by the traffic manager to determine if a mitigation strategy must be initiated. If a mitigation strategy must be initiated, the policy engine determines a target node to receive the mitigation strategy and translates the mitigation strategy into a format understandable to the target node and pushes a mitigation command containing the mitigation strategy to the target node.Type: GrantFiled: June 29, 2020Date of Patent: April 5, 2022Assignee: Star2Star Communications, LLCInventors: Sergey Galchenko, Norman A Worthington, III
-
Patent number: 11288604Abstract: A resource processing method and apparatus. The method is achieved by a computer configured to execute the following steps: generating a resource allocation chart based on a resource allocation request; processing the resource allocation chart and generating an access entrance of the resource allocation chart; opening the access entrance to enable at least one third party resource supplier to respond to the resource allocation request via the access entrance. The method further comprises: when the resources are not available or not suitable for allocation, receiving a resource allocation chart, wherein the resource allocation chart is based on the resource allocation request; generating an access entrance of the resource allocation chart; opening the access entrance to at least one third party resource supplier; and receiving the allocated resources from the at least one third party resource supplier by responding to the resource allocation request through the access entrance.Type: GrantFiled: June 19, 2019Date of Patent: March 29, 2022Assignee: ADVANCED NEW TECHNOLOGIES CO., LTD.Inventors: Zhirong Yang, Xin Dai, Hai Ma, Fangcheng Mei, Mei Liu, Qian Wan, Qiaoyong Liu, Hualiang Dong, Zhixu Wang, Weiwei Ding
-
Patent number: 11283894Abstract: For caching of cognitive applications in a communication network a first input signal from a sensor device is detected by a proxy having a cache associated therewith. A representation of the first input signal is computed and sent to a server. A handle function is applied to the representation of the first input signal to compute a first handle value corresponding to the first input signal. The representation of the first input signal is transformed using a cognitive processing model of an answer function to compute a first answer value. A content of the cache is modified by the proxy by storing the first answer value in association with the first handle value in the cache.Type: GrantFiled: December 21, 2020Date of Patent: March 22, 2022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Dinesh Verma, Mudhakar Srivatsa